Stick Posted September 18, 2008 Posted September 18, 2008 Check your Terrain targets ini. 1.Are you in enemy territory? 2.Does the enemy begin first offensive?If so then the base may come under their control. This used to happen to me with stationing squadrons in Cyprus,EVEN AFTER changing the targets ini entry fom ENEMY to FRIENDLY. It could possibly be because in your campaign data.ini you may have FORCEWITHINITIATVE=2
Guest pfunkmusik Posted September 18, 2008 Posted September 18, 2008 Yes. OK, I can tell you exactly what's happening. If I fail on the first mission, my base is now an enemy base. It's as if I'm in captured territory, but the engine forgot to move me to a safer base. Or they just seriously gained ground all over the place. pfunk
